Position Summary
UNC School of Law seeks a motivated and detail-oriented Development Administrative Assistant to provide essential administrative and operational support to a dynamic and results-driven Advancement team. This temporary full-time position plays a key role in ensuring accurate gift processing meaningful donor stewardship and effective alumni and volunteer engagement. The initial priority for this role will be to complete a robust alumni research project by January 30. Following the successful completion of this project additional responsibilities may include gift processing donor stewardship activities and support for alumni and volunteer engagement initiatives. Extension of the position beyond the initial project will be based on organizational needs and performance. The ideal candidate is highly organized comfortable working with data and systems and enjoys contributing to relationship-based fundraising in a collaborative fast-paced higher education environment. This position is based on-site at UNC Chapel Hill with the option for a hybrid schedule of up to two remote days per week after 30 days of employment. Required Qualifications Competencies And Experience
Research alumni records for multiple law class years to ensure accuracy of employment and contact information. Process gifts efficiently and accurately to ensure seamless donor transactions. Implement weekly stewardship activities to express gratitude and foster strong relationships with our valued donors. Generate reports and assist in data analysis to inform strategic decision-making. Provide comprehensive support for donor and volunteer communications ensuring timely and personalized interactions. Assist with alumni relations initiatives to engage our network of graduates. Support board and committee activities by coordinating meetings preparing materials and facilitating communications. Maintain accurate records and ensure data integrity in our constituent management system DAVIE . Prior administrative experience in fundraising within a higher education or nonprofit environment is preferred. Proficiency with database management systems with specific experience in UNC DAVIE considered a strong advantage. Familiarity with UNC and its organizational structure is desirable. Strong organizational skills and attention to detail with the ability to manage multiple tasks efficiently. Excellent written and verbal communication skills. Collaborative spirit and ability to work effectively in a team-oriented environment.
